Job Description
- The Pharmacy Technician is responsible for placing outbound calls to physician offices to obtain verbal authorization for prescription refill renewals when previous outreach attempts have not received a response.
- This role supports continuity of patient care by ensuring refill requests are addressed in a timely and compliant manner while maintaining professionalism and accuracy in all communications.
- Strong verbal communication and professional phone etiquette.
- Ability to speak confidently with physician office staff and healthcare professionals.
- Basic computer proficiency and ability to navigate multiple systems simultaneously.
- Strong attention to detail and accurate documentation skills.
- Ability to manage repetitive tasks while maintaining quality and focus.
- Ability to set up computer, vpn and other application at home
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Able to apply basic computer skills. Kn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ite: Excel and Word required;Access, Outlook, PowerPoint, Visio preferable. Keyboard skills essential.
- Must be able to multitask and utilize multiple system applications simultaneously.
- Basic pharmaceutical knowledge pertaining to terminology, calculations, and protocols.
- Must be able to utilize available resources independently and provide high quality work.
- Must be able to absorb presented information, display motivation, seek development and problem solve.
- Ability to adapt and change with workflow and shifting priorities.
- Must possess excellent written, verbal, grammar, and listening communication skills.
- Must be able to deal with a diverse customer base (internal and external) in a friendly and confident manner.
- Ability to maintain confidentiality of PHI (Protected Healthcare Information).
- Previous experience in a call center, healthcare, pharmacy, or customer service environment.
- Familiarity with prescription refill processes and medical office workflows.
- Knowledge of HIPAA regulations and patient confidentiality requirements.
- Verifiable High School diploma or GED is required.
